Reliable evidence crucial to Tribunal claims

SIBU: The Consumer Claims Tribunal on Monday dismissed a houseowner’s claim after he failed to show evidence that the tiles he had bought from a company were defective. House ownership for civil servants via PPAM projects

KOTA SAMARAHAN: The six Malaysian Civil Servants’ Housing (PPAM) projects in Sarawak are among 273 housing projects approved for development throughout the nation by the Housing and Local Government Ministry.
